Output 66b3c59897daa260606d1cb2ae4f79af59fdf8699eaff095ce8b02a11660e26a:21
- value
- 340193
- script pubkey
- OP_0 OP_PUSHBYTES_20 789f548c52c8275f9f40df4d39bac3deb35b6e2e
- address
- bc1q0z04frzjeqn4l86qmaxnnwkrm6e4km3wgshc09
- transaction
- 66b3c59897daa260606d1cb2ae4f79af59fdf8699eaff095ce8b02a11660e26a